In 2023, the total operational greenhouse gas (GHG) emissions of Microport Scientific amounted to 48,747 metric tons of CO2 equivalent. This figure includes both direct emissions from owned or controlled sources (Scope 1) and indirect emissions from purchased energy (Scope 2).
Compared to 2022, the total operational greenhouse gas (GHG) emissions of Microport Scientific increased by 0.9%, suggesting that the company faced challenges in reducing its emissions from its core operations.
In 2023, the total Scope 1 emissions of Microport Scientific were 3,168 metric tons of COâ‚‚ equivalent (tCOâ‚‚e).
Compared to the previous year (2022), Microport Scientific's Scope 1 emissions increased by 100.51%, suggesting that the company faced challenges in reducing emissions from its directly owned or controlled operations.
In 2023, Microport Scientific reported Scope 2 greenhouse gas (GHG) emissions of 45,579 tCOâ‚‚e without specifying the calculation method.
Compared to the previous year (2022), Microport Scientific's Scope 2 emissions (Unspecified Calculation Method) have remained relatively stable, indicating that Microport Scientific 's emissions have plateaued with no significant change in its energy consumption footprint.
